Storing & Cooking Your Meat: A Complete Guide
Before you fire up the grill or toss your meat into a simmering pot, it's crucial to understand the ins and check here outs of freezing and cooking. Effectively freezing meat is essential for maintaining its quality and safety. By following these simple steps, you can ensure that your meat stays fresh, flavorful, and ready to cook whenever you need it.
- Initiate by identifying the optimal type of meat for freezing. Lean cuts freeze better.
- Encase your meat tightly in freezer-safe plastic wrap or aluminum foil to prevent freezer burn.
- Label the type of meat and the date it was frozen for easy identification.
